ICONIC MARQUEES ACROSS 20 MUSIC VENUES NATIONWIDE HONOR THE LEGENDARY QUEEN OF SOUL, ARETHA FRANKLIN

#GeniusAF Marquee Takeover Leads into Premiere of GENIUS: ARETHA; The Highly Anticipated Series, Starring Double Oscar(R) Nominee Cynthia Erivo, Premiering on National Geographic on Sunday, March 21 With Episodes Available Next Day On Hulu

Washington, D.C. - Mar. 19, 2021) -- National Geographic's GENIUS: ARETHA partners with Live Nation for a nationwide marquee takeover to honor the legacy of the "Queen of Soul," Aretha Franklin. Twenty marquees will go live beginning Monday, March 15 through Wednesday, March 24.

These marquees will once again place Franklin in her rightful spot as a headliner with "All Hail The Queen #GeniusAF 3.21.21." During an unprecedented time in history, this GENIUS: ARETHA activation not only spotlights the indisputable Queen of Soul's legacy, but also uplifts live music venues across the nation. Additionally, as part of this activation National Geographic is making a donation to Crew Nation, a global relief fund launched by Live Nation and powered by nonprofit partner Music Forward Foundation that provides financial support for live music crews impacted by the global pandemic and beyond.

From 20th Television and Imagine Television, this new season of the Emmy award-winning anthology series will premiere on National Geographic with double-stacked episodes across four consecutive nights, beginning on Sunday, March 21, at 9/8c. The premiere episodes will be available the next day on Hulu, culminating in a celebration of Aretha Franklin's birthday, with all eight episodes available to stream by Thursday, March 25.

Genius is National Geographic's critically acclaimed anthology series that dramatizes the fascinating stories of the world's most brilliant innovators and their extraordinary achievements with their volatile, passionate and complex personal relationships. This third season will explore Aretha Franklin's musical genius and incomparable career, as well as the immeasurable impact and lasting influence she has had on music and culture around the world. Franklin was a gospel prodigy, an outspoken civil rights champion and widely considered the greatest singer of the past 50 years, receiving countless honors throughout her career. Genius: Aretha will be the first-ever, definitive and only authorized scripted series on the life of the universally acclaimed Queen of Soul.
